Umm... So I just got Project M 3.6.
Everything is working properly.
I just want to change the title and banner of the file when it shows up in Dolphin.

You're supposed to be able to set an icon by creating a file named either <name of the ELF>.png or icon.png and putting it in the same folder as the ELF. This is currently broken in the development builds – Dolphin only loads the icon if the game isn't in the game list cache – but it should work fine on 5.0.

There's unfortunately not any way to override the name yet, but the plans are to allowing doing that with HBC-style XML files.

By the way, is it possible to rename a .iso game in Dolphin?
(09-08-2017, 05:58 PM)BoCoi144 Wrote: [ -> ]By the way, is it possible to rename a .iso game in Dolphin?

Yes. The way I would recommend doing it is by creating a titles.txt file, as described here: https://forums.dolphin-emu.org/Thread-un...-and-maker
